  • The bachelor's in the theatre program allows students to learn how to work collaboratively with other creative minds to solve problems and communicate on the stage and behind the scenes.
  • Develop a core set of skills to become highly proficient in theory, knowledge, and practice while learning self-discipline and work ethic
  • Students will gain the skills and education needed to succeed on and off the stage with a hybrid learning experience that combines traditional courses with production work.
  • This major provides students with foundational knowledge about theatre while teaching interdependent studies such as acting, design, direction, technology, management, history, theory, criticism, and dramatic literature.

VISA

International applicants are required to apply for an F-1 or J-1 student Visa. As per the application process of universities in the USA, a student needs to have the following basic documents to procure a US student visa.

  • A valid passport that has a validity of a minimum of 6 months after students stay in the country
  • Form DS-160 (Nonimmigrant visa application confirmation page)
  • Application fee payment Receipt
  • Form I-20 if applying for a Student visa (Certificate of Eligibility for Nonimmigrant Student Status)
  • Receipt Number on Petition filed by U.S employer (I-129 form) if applying for a work visa.
  • Original Marks Sheet or Provisional certificates.
  • Evidence of sufficient funds in the bank account to ensure you can survive the duration of course in the USA.
  • Score sheet of standardized exams like IELTS (6.0 or equivalent), TOEFL, GMAT, GRE, etc.
  • Proof that the candidate will leave the country once the program is completed. A return air ticket to the home country can be evidence of this kind.
